这个问题的表述可能有些模糊,但我会尝试解释并提供一个可能的解决方案。首先,我们需要明确“计算值”和“下一个偏移值”的含义。假设我们有一个数据集,其中每一行都有一个数值和一个偏移值。我们的目标是找出那些数值小于其对应偏移值的行数。
这种类型的分析可能用于金融数据分析(比如股票价格与其预期价格比较)、性能监控(实际性能与目标性能比较)等领域。
假设我们有一个CSV文件,其中包含两列:Value
和 Offset
。我们可以使用Python和Pandas库来处理这个问题。
import pandas as pd
# 假设df是加载的数据框
df = pd.read_csv('data.csv')
# 计算小于各自下一个偏移值的行数
count = df[df['Value'] < df['Offset']].shape[0]
print(f"小于各自下一个偏移值的行数: {count}")
pd.read_csv
函数加载数据。df[df['Value'] < df['Offset']]
找出所有Value
小于Offset
的行。.shape[0]
获取满足条件的行数。Offset
是指向下一个行的值,可能需要稍微调整逻辑来正确获取下一个值。这个解决方案提供了一个基本的框架,根据具体的数据结构和需求,可能需要进一步的调整。如果问题中的“下一个偏移值”有特殊的含义或者来源,需要提供更多的细节以便给出更精确的答案。
领取专属 10元无门槛券
手把手带您无忧上云